mysql中怎么轉(zhuǎn)義 mysql語句轉(zhuǎn)換

Java中字符串帶\怎么放在MySQL中

1、\n 換行符。\r 回車符。\t tab字符。\Z ASCII 26(控制(Ctrl)-Z)。該字符可以編碼為‘\Z’,以允許你解決在Windows中ASCII 26代表文件結(jié)尾這一問題。

創(chuàng)新互聯(lián)建站專注于企業(yè)成都全網(wǎng)營銷、網(wǎng)站重做改版、華池網(wǎng)站定制設(shè)計、自適應(yīng)品牌網(wǎng)站建設(shè)、H5頁面制作、商城建設(shè)、集團公司官網(wǎng)建設(shè)、外貿(mào)網(wǎng)站制作、高端網(wǎng)站制作、響應(yīng)式網(wǎng)頁設(shè)計等建站業(yè)務(wù),價格優(yōu)惠性價比高,為華池等各大城市提供網(wǎng)站開發(fā)制作服務(wù)。

2、而MySQL另外一個最流行的存儲引擎之一Innodb存儲數(shù)據(jù)的策略是分為兩種的,一種是共享表空間存儲方式,還有一種是獨享表空間存儲方式。

3、使用工具:java語言、Myeclipse。

4、ASCII編碼:將ASCII字符集轉(zhuǎn)換為計算機可以接受的數(shù)字系統(tǒng)的數(shù)的規(guī)則。

有個mysql存儲過程,當字符串參數(shù)傳進去帶單引號,就會報錯,請問怎么解決...

你可以把一個轉(zhuǎn)義字符(“\”)放在引號前面。一個字符串內(nèi)用“”加引號的“”不需要特殊對待而且不必被重復(fù)或轉(zhuǎn)義。同理,一個字符串內(nèi)用“”加引號的與“”也不需要特殊對待。

通常這樣會產(chǎn)生SQL注入,建議加個過濾的功能,或者下載個安全狗嚴格防范下。

就是使用string.Format()方法格式化字符串! 使用方法和輸出語句相同。

在mysql中in里面如果是字符串的話,會自動轉(zhuǎn)化成int類型的,內(nèi)部使用了如下方法: CAST(4,3 AS INT)導(dǎo)致’4,3‘ 變成了4,所以上述查詢sql結(jié)果只有第一個。

可以運行的,你把char類型加個整數(shù)1,類型轉(zhuǎn)換錯誤,就報異常了,存儲過程字符用varchar類型的比較多一些。

再測試下應(yīng)該就可以。當然還要保證你的server client 底層存數(shù)據(jù)的默認編碼是utf.至少要gbk,如果默認是latin1要改下。

mysql插入json自動轉(zhuǎn)義

mysql select json_keys(@ytt,$.name[0]);+---+| json_keys(@ytt,$.name[0]) |+---+| [a, b] |+---+1 row in set (0.00 sec)我們使用MySQL 0 的JSON_TABLE 來轉(zhuǎn)換 @ytt。

JSON_INSERT 添加新值, 但不替換現(xiàn)有值:JSON_REPLACE 替換現(xiàn)有值并忽略新值:JSON_REMOVE 使用一個或多個路徑, 這些路徑指定要從文檔中刪除的值。

mysqljson格式數(shù)據(jù)通過三個步驟導(dǎo)出不被轉(zhuǎn)義:在需要解析的字段上加上JsonRawValue即可解析出無轉(zhuǎn)義符號的JSON。后端去除轉(zhuǎn)義字符。前端利用replacet替換轉(zhuǎn)義字符。

decode()函數(shù),變成數(shù)組以后就可以方便操作了,可以刪除數(shù)組中的任意一項,也可以增加一項比如:array_push($data,[sort=3,catentryId=10003]),再變成json格式的存入數(shù)據(jù)庫。

在mysql中使用字符串時,兩端要帶上單引號,否則會出現(xiàn)語法錯誤。不建議將字符串硬編碼到SQL中,因為字符串中有可能含有特殊字符。一般采用變量綁定,或是使用addslashes對單引號進行轉(zhuǎn)義。

mysql中怎么做unpivot

1、沒在mysql中試過,不過最近在使用集算器,可以給樓主做下參考。

2、現(xiàn)在,要建立一個審計記錄來追蹤對這個表格所做的改變。這個記錄將反映表格的每項改變,并向用戶說明由誰做出改變以及改變的時間。需要建立一個新表格來存儲這一信息(表格名:audit),如下所示。

3、redo log是InnoDB引擎特有的;binlog是MySQL的Server層實現(xiàn)的,所有引擎都可以使用。 redo log是物理日志,記錄的是在某個數(shù)據(jù)頁上做了什么修改;binlog是邏輯日志,記錄的是這個語句的原始邏輯,比如給ID=2這一行的c字段加1。

4、explain+索引。在你要查詢的語句前加explain,看下有沒有用到索引,如果出現(xiàn)type為all的,則說明有必要添加下索引。(附多表查詢速度比較:表關(guān)聯(lián)existsin)慢查詢優(yōu)化是一大塊。預(yù)統(tǒng)計。

5、至于怎樣修改還是新開發(fā)哪個方便這個就要看你的老系統(tǒng)做的怎么樣了,如果老系統(tǒng)擴展性比較好,結(jié)構(gòu)也比較優(yōu)化合理的話,應(yīng)該問題不大,簡單的加幾個字段,程序里面稍微改下就OK了。

1嗎?'>mysql中可以使用轉(zhuǎn)義字符\001嗎?

1、場景 使用sqoop從MySQL導(dǎo)出數(shù)據(jù)至Hive時,如果數(shù)據(jù)中包含hive指定的列分隔符,如\001 或\t,那么在Hive中就會導(dǎo)致數(shù)據(jù)錯位;如果數(shù)據(jù)中包含換行符\n,那么就會導(dǎo)致原先的一行數(shù)據(jù),在Hive中變成了兩行。

2、MySql字符轉(zhuǎn)義 在字符串中,某些序列具有特殊含義。這些序列均用反斜線(‘\’)開始,即所謂的轉(zhuǎn)義字符。MySQL識別下面的轉(zhuǎn)義序列:\0 ASCII 0(NUL)字符。\ 單引號(‘’)。\ 雙引號(‘’)。\b 退格符。

3、一個字符串內(nèi)用“”加引號的“”不需要特殊對待而且不必被重復(fù)或轉(zhuǎn)義。同理,一個字符串內(nèi)用“”加引號的與“”也不需要特殊對待。

4、在字符串中,某些序列具有特殊含義。這些序列均用反斜線(‘\’)開始,即所謂的轉(zhuǎn)義字符。MySQL識別下面的轉(zhuǎn)義序列:\0 一個 ASCII 0 (NUL) 字符。\一個 ASCII 39 單引號 (“”) 字符。

mysql數(shù)據(jù)庫的insert語句中如果出現(xiàn)分號,該怎么轉(zhuǎn)義其入庫

有兩種方法,一種方法使用mysql的check table和repair table 的sql語句,另一種方法是使用MySQL提供的多個myisamchk, isamchk數(shù)據(jù)檢測恢復(fù)工具。前者使用起來比較簡便。推薦使用。

在mysql中要向數(shù)據(jù)庫中保存數(shù)據(jù)我們最常用的一種方法就是直接使用Insert into語句來實現(xiàn)了,下面我來給大家詳細介紹Insert into語句用法 INSERT用于向一個已有的表中插入新行。INSERT…VALUES語句根據(jù)明確指定的值插入行。

基礎(chǔ)的Insert語句示例 下面的語句向員工表插入一條新記錄。在這個例子中,后的“values”指定要插入到表中的所有字段對應(yīng)的值。

MySQL命令語句需要用“;”結(jié)束,表示一條命令。分號是在數(shù)據(jù)庫系統(tǒng)中分隔每條 SQL 語句的標準方法,這樣就可以在對服務(wù)器的相同請求中執(zhí)行一條以上的語句。

用于操作數(shù)據(jù)庫的SQL一般分為兩種,一種是查詢語句,也就是我們所說的SELECT語句,另外一種就是更新語句,也叫做數(shù)據(jù)操作語句。言外之意,就是對數(shù)據(jù)進行修改。在標準的SQL中有3個語句,它們是INSERT、UPDATE以及DELETE。

網(wǎng)站欄目:mysql中怎么轉(zhuǎn)義 mysql語句轉(zhuǎn)換
URL鏈接:http://muchs.cn/article8/diigjip.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供動態(tài)網(wǎng)站移動網(wǎng)站建設(shè)、搜索引擎優(yōu)化外貿(mào)網(wǎng)站建設(shè)、網(wǎng)站策劃ChatGPT

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)

綿陽服務(wù)器托管